Tish Talks about the "Balance & Grounding" metaphysical properties of stones on Saturday, July 11 from 1 to 1:30 p.m. at The Nature of Art in Holly Springs. FREE. Make a piece of jewelry after the talk if you like for $8.
"Making jewelry has become my passion, my obsession, my therapy, my joy," says Tish McDermott, artist. Tish works with beads and stones in their truest form, by working with the elemental nature of the stones.
For balancing both mental and emotional, Tish recommends bloodstone, carnalian, hematite, sodalite, and tigers eye, just to name a few.
For centering and grounding, try bloodstone, calcite or hematite. Other grounding stones are agate, bloodstone, hematite, obsidian, salt, smoky quartz, and more. Notice some stones cross over both aspects.
Improve your mental steadiness, create more emotional stability or improve grounding for a more solid foundation, all by choosing the proper stones to wear or carry.
